About us:

Checkmate Sea Energy are developers of the Anaconda Wave Energy Converter, an innovative flexible solution to wave energy harvesting. Checkmate Sea Energy have been working on R&D of the Anaconda system since 2009, however a significant update to the Lobe-Tendon Anaconda in 2020 has reinvigorated development with a small but committed team.
